    July 20, 1932 — Gyeongseong, South Korea [now Seoul]

    Nam June Paik was the first video artist who experimented with electronic media and made a profound impact on the art of video and television. He coined the phrase "Information Superhighway" in 1974, and has been called the "father of video art."
